Nunez is wanted by a Saudi giant
A British media report said that Liverpool striker Darwin Nunez is wanted in the Saudi League in the coming period.
The Anfield Watch account, via the X platform, stated that Al Hilal Saudi Arabia wants In including Nunez at the request of coach Jorge Jesus.
The source added that Jesus wants to work again with Nunez, after they worked together in Benfica.
The source concluded that Liverpool are willing to sell him, but set his price at 85 million pounds sterling.
